Evolución electrofisiológica de un grupo de pacientes con Polineuropatía Desmielinizante Inflamatoria Crónica primaria y secundaria / Electrophysiological evolution of a group of patients with primary and secondary cipd

RESUMEN

Introducción:

La Polineuropatía Desmielinizante Inflamatoria Crónica (CIDP) es tiene diferentes formas clínicas de presentación; la forma idiopática y la relacionada con enfermedades concurrentes. Los estudios neurofisiológicos juegan un papel determinante en el diagnóstico.

Objetivos:

Nos propusimos comparar la evolución electrofisiológica a través del análisis de las variables evaluadas a través del estudio de conducción nerviosa de un grupo de pacientes con CIDP primaria y secundaria en dos momentos evolutivos de la enfermedad.

Metodos:

Se estudiaron 9 pacientes con CIDP primaria 6 con CIDP relacionada con diabetes mellitus, esclerosis múltiple y adenocarcinoma. Se les realizó estudio de conducción nerviosa de los nervios de extremidades, en el momento del diagnóstico de la enfermedad y al año de tratamiento. Se compararon las variables electrofisiológicas en ambos momentos utilizando técnicas de estadística no paramétricas.

Resultados:

Los pacientes con CIDP primaria mostraron mejoría evolutiva de las variables electrofisiológicas, con normalización del estudio en dos casos. Mientras que en los pacientes con CIDP secundaria existió empeoramiento.

Conclusiones:

Concluimos que los pacientes con CIDP secundaria muestran una evolución electrofisiológica tórpida con pronóstico reservado.
ABSTRACT

Introduction:

Chronic Inflammatory Demyelinating Polyneuropathy (CIDP) has different forms of presentation; the idiopathic form and that related to concurrent diseases. The neurophysiological studies play a fundamental role in the diagnosis. Objetives We proposed to compare the electrophysiological evolution by analyzing the variables evaluated through the nervous conduction study of a group of patients with primary and secondary CIDP at two evolutive moments of the disease.

Methods:

9 patients with primary CIDP and 6 with CIDP related to diabetes mellitus, multiple sclerosis and adenocarcinoma were studied. A nervous conduction study of the nerves of the extremities was performed at the moment of the diagnosis of the disease and a year after treatment. The electrophysiological variables were compared in both moments by using nonparametric statistical techniques.

Results:

The patients with primary CIDP showed evolutive improvement of the electrophysiological variables with normalization of the study in two cases. Patients with secondary CIDP got worse.

Conclusions:

It was concluded that patients with secondary CIDP showed a torpid electrophysiological evolution with reserved prognosis.
